What is the reason for acne on both sides of the cheeks

Acne on the cheeks has a certain impact on the health of the cheek skin. There are two major factors for acne on both sides of the cheeks. One is physical factors, and the other is caused by external environmental stimulation. In order to relieve and treat it, you must first find out the cause.

1. Mental factors are one of the reasons why teenagers get acne on both sides of their cheeks. In addition, the sebaceous glands secrete excessive oil, which can easily clog the pores, causing inflammation and causing acne. Teenagers between the ages of fifteen and twenty are most likely to develop acne.

2. The face secretes a lot of oil. In order not to affect their image, many people will over-wash their faces, which results in the skin being too dry. If there is no good moisturizing product in daily care, the skin will be overly exposed to external stimulation, leading to acne.

3. The Corynebacterium acnes, Staphylococcus albus and Pityriasis ovale present in the hair follicles, especially the Corynebacterium acnes, contain esterase that decomposes sebum. The sebum in the hair follicles is decomposed by lipase to produce more free fatty acids. These free fatty acids can cause non-specific inflammatory reactions in the hair follicles and around the hair follicles. When the tiny ulcers and free fatty acids of the acne wall enter the nearby dermis, and the blackheads squeeze the nearby cells, their antibacterial ability decreases and they are easily infected by bacteria and cause inflammation. As a result, the patient develops papules, pustules, nodules, nodules and abscesses.
